Solution Overview
Problem
Existing instant messaging systems lack the ability to automatically update a user's status based on text entered during a conversation, requiring manual input and not allowing for seamless integration of the conversational context into the user's status update.
Innovation Solution
A method and system that allows users to initiate an instant messaging conversation and automatically change their status by inputting a predefined indicator and text, optionally including the conversational partner's name, with preferences controlling whether the status change is shared with the other user and sent to them.

Data Source
AI summary
An embodiment of the invention provides a method for communication within a system, wherein an instant messaging conversation is initiated between a first user and a second user. An indicator and a text entry are received from the first user during the instant messaging conversation. The status of the first user is changed, including automatically setting the text entry as the status of the first user, and automatically including the name of the second user in the status of the first user if preferences of the first user indicate that the name of the second user is to be included in the status of the first user. Further, the text entry is automatically sent to the second user if the preferences of the first user indicate that a text entry following the indicator is to be automatically sent to the second user.
